Finding a replacement for an Audi is not an simple task. Audi keys come with transponder chips that allows them to connect with vehicle systems. This technology is utilized for the prevention of theft and fraud. This technology can also be used to unlock doors, tailgates, and start the engine. This feature is especially helpful for those who are unable to reach their keys or are too busy to manually open the door.
In most instances the case, a locksmith or dealer certified by Audi will be required to give you a the new Audi key. These professionals have the equipment and expertise to ensure that the new key is properly programmed. They can also determine whether the old key is still working correctly. Audi's smart keys use a transponder chip embedded in the blades of the keys to disable the immobiliser standard on their vehicles. It can be difficult to comprehend the procedure and therefore it is recommended that you work with an automotive locksmith that is skilled in Audi keys. They will have the tools and knowledge to create a new key that can be used with the immobiliser system. They'll also be able program the key for your specific vehicle.

If you have an older model Audi, it may be difficult to find a locksmith that can cut the key for you. This is because the key requires laser cutting technology, which isn't readily available in many hardware stores. Fortunately, a few locksmiths that specialize in automotive have this equipment and will offer a replacement key at lower cost. This option comes with a disadvantage it that you must wait for a few days before the new key can be programmed into your vehicle.

If you are planning to replace your Audi key with a new one, you must inform your insurer that the original one has been lost. This will stop the insurance company from treating your loss as a stolen item, and will keep your premiums low. The dealer will need to purchase the key code from Germany in order to make an appropriate replacement.
